I have a band. I got it in 2008. My heaviest weight was around 350. I was 314 on the day of surgery and got down to 223. I was ok with my band. Of Course I hated the throwing up - especially when it was just  water; and I could not drink anything with sugar - that always came back up.
I am having a revision because I have recently been diagnosed with a condition that is causing me to go blind. Believe it or not, weight is the culprit. My spinal chord produces too much fluid and it does so based on what it perceives my weight to be. My insurance company has approved me for the bypass - waiving the 6 month diet. My eyes are getting worse, it seems as the days go by, but still I am not ready for the bypass. I am afraid and I don't have enough information on it. I have to take sveral pills everyday (all relatively small) and will continue to do so until I am small enough to not have to anymore. I need help and information - QUICK!!!!.

Band to sleeve revision here. Best damn decision I ever made. I'm almost 2 years out, as you can see in my ticker, I'm over 13 weeks pregnant, and I'm thriving. My labs are stellar, my little Sprout is growing, and we are doing fabulous. I have zero food or medication intolerances, nor do I have to take ****pots of vitamins/supplements even in pregnancy as I have no malabsorption. Nor do I have to worry about a pouch ever again.

Life is pretty sweet post-op. I had maintained my 138lb loss for nearly a year before I got pregnant. If you have any specific questions, please feel free to contact me privately.
